Stump is the lower section of the tree containing the root that has been left behind after the tree has been cut down. If you are planning on getting some of the trees in your yard cut down, you need to make sure that stump removal Streetsboro is included in the package. Streetsboro stump removal is crucial especially if you have kids at home. Unlike adults, children can become really unconscious of their surroundings. Because of this, they are more likely to get injured by unseen stump laying around in your yard. Stumps can also decrease the curb appeal of your property. They can be gruesome, distracting and an enormous eyesore. If you are planning on enhancing your lawn, a stump can get in the way. It would make mowing your lawn difficult if you needed to avoid it every now and then. A rotting stump can also attract insects that can be a big nuisance in your yard. If ignored, these insects can even get inside your home. May homeowners try to remove stump on their own, but it is not advisable. Not only is it a complex task, but it also requires tools that a regular homeowner may not have. Stump removal Streetsboro should best be done by a highly skilled and well equipped professional to ensure that you will only get the best result.

Professional stump removal Streetsboro companies may charge their clients based on various criteria like the diameter of the stump, the number of stumps to be removed, and clearing the land after the removal. The average cost of a professional stump removal is around MIN_HOURLY%.Per diameter, the charge is around $2 to $3. Most companies have a minimum charge of $267. If the charge is by the number of stumps to be removed, companies may offer price breaks if you have more than one stump to be removed. For example, you may be charged $267 to $376 for your first stump, but the price may reduce to $30 or $50 for the succeeding ones. If you are planning on clearing a vast expanse of land for a landscaping project and there are a lot of stumps to be removed along with it, stump removal Streetsboro companies may charge you a flat rate fee. Usually, you may be charged $150 per hour. You may also be charged based on the average diameter of the stumps. For example, if the average diameter of the stumps is 12 inches and there are 200 stumps to be removed, that will be a total of 2400 inches to be cleared. At a rate of $2 per inch, you can be charged $4800 for the project.
